NAEP Technical DocumentationLinking Diagram for the Reading Samples: 2009

The bridging sample, which was comprised of linking and reconfigured samples, was used to convert the standard NAEP booklet design that had been used in the 1998 assessment to the new design planned for use during the 2002 assessment and beyond. The bridging sample results were not reported.
NOTE: The arrowheads point to samples for which assessment results were already in the NAEP reporting metric in preparation for the 2009 reading assessment. The Reading Framework for the 2009 National Assessment of Educational Progress replaces the framework first used for the 1992 reading assessment and then for subsequent reading assessments through 2007. Results from special analyses determined the 2009 reading assessment results could be compared with those from earlier assessment years. A summary of these special analyses and an overview of the differences between the previous framework and the 2009 framework are available on the Web at http://nces.ed.gov/nationsreportcard/reading/trend_study.asp
